Norwich City have confirmed two home friendlies as part of the Canaries' pre-season schedule.
Saturday, July 25 will see former United player and now reserve manager Ole Gunnar Solskjaer bringing a Manchester United XI to Carrow Road (3pm).
This match will be followed by former Canary Steve Bruce bringing his Premier League Wigan Athletic to Carrow Road on Saturday, August 1 (3pm).
Tickets for these matches are priced at �10 for adults, �5 for under-21s/over-60s and �3 for under-16s. Tickets are on general sale from 9am on May 18 with season ticket holders having until June 20 to claim their seat before they are released for general sale.
A further first team away friendly is currently being organised for Tuesday, July 28 and details will be confirmed in due course.
